Diversified Communications in Brighton is seeking an experienced content professional to drive content strategy for their food & drink trade event portfolio. In this full-time role, you will manage PR activities, social media engagement, and contribute to internal communications.

The ideal candidate has 4-5 years in content or PR, with strong copywriting skills and a collaborative spirit.

Benefits include flexible working, professional development, and a robust wellness package.
